I have the original in Spanish - can't guarantee that it's correct but here it is anyway:

"Infando, absurdo y hasta ingrato habría sido negar tan urgente auxilio. No sólo se paga KARMA por el mal que se hace, sino por el bien que se deja de hacer, pudiéndose hacer."

So apparently the original said "pay" and the translator went with that.

(I wish I knew how to write stuff in italics but alas... The relevant words are "se paga".)

But I think we can be quite sure that the intended meaning was 'made'...

To put things in italics you would type a less than sign and then the word cite and then a greater than sign at the beginning of the text you want to italisize. Then at the end of the text you want italilsized you type a less than sign, then a forward slash, then the word cite, then a greater than sign. Like this only no spaces:

< cite > words you want italisized < / cite >

You can also use the em tag as follows (only no spaces between)

< em > words you want italisized < / em >

bolded is as follows:

< strong > words you want bolded < / strong >

If you want to italisize and bold text, then you use two tags "stacked", as follows:

< cite > < strong > text you want < / strong > < / cite >

italisized
bolded
both bolded & italisized

It's called HTML tags and the ones supported here are listed at the bottom when you make a post.
